Oceancash Pacific Bhd (0049) — Working Capital to Net Assets Ratio

Latest as of December 2025: 37.9%

Oceancash Pacific Bhd (0049) has a Working Capital to Net Assets ratio of 37.9% as of December 2025. Working capital of RM43.76 Million (current assets of RM52.81 Million minus current liabilities of RM9.04 Million) is measured against net assets of RM115.59 Million. Annual Working Capital to Net Assets for Oceancash Pacific Bhd (2006–2025)

The table below presents the year-by-year Working Capital to Net Assets ratio for Oceancash Pacific Bhd from 2006 to 2025, covering 20 annual filings. Each row shows current assets, current liabilities, working capital, net assets, the ratio,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. Year WC/NA Ratio Working Capital (MYR) Net Assets Current Assets Current Liabilities Change (pp)
2025 37.9% RM43.76 Million RM115.59 Million RM52.81 Million RM9.04 Million ▲ +5.4 pp
2024 32.5% RM39.11 Million RM120.45 Million RM49.52 Million RM10.41 Million ▼ -2.4 pp
2023 34.9% RM42.83 Million RM122.77 Million RM57.44 Million RM14.61 Million ▼ -6.2 pp
2022 41.1% RM47.96 Million RM116.61 Million RM59.10 Million RM11.15 Million ▲ +2.3 pp
2021 38.8% RM43.37 Million RM111.71 Million RM59.10 Million RM15.73 Million ▲ +7.1 pp
2020 31.7% RM34.40 Million RM108.53 Million RM51.05 Million RM16.66 Million ▼ -1.8 pp
2019 33.5% RM29.98 Million RM89.54 Million RM45.58 Million RM15.61 Million ▼ -4.7 pp
2018 38.2% RM32.13 Million RM84.14 Million RM48.03 Million RM15.90 Million ▲ +3.3 pp
2017 34.9% RM28.34 Million RM81.30 Million RM46.68 Million RM18.34 Million ▲ +8.6 pp
2016 26.3% RM19.78 Million RM75.25 Million RM40.58 Million RM20.80 Million ▲ +6.6 pp
2015 19.7% RM13.02 Million RM66.01 Million RM31.84 Million RM18.82 Million ▼ -6.4 pp
2014 26.1% RM15.18 Million RM58.05 Million RM32.64 Million RM17.47 Million ▼ -6.7 pp
2013 32.9% RM16.19 Million RM49.25 Million RM34.97 Million RM18.78 Million ▲ +12.7 pp
2012 20.2% RM8.87 Million RM43.88 Million RM26.86 Million RM17.99 Million ▲ +7.2 pp
2011 13.0% RM5.45 Million RM42.00 Million RM27.12 Million RM21.67 Million ▼ -2.3 pp
2010 15.3% RM6.17 Million RM40.25 Million RM24.77 Million RM18.60 Million ▲ +2.3 pp
2009 13.0% RM5.06 Million RM38.89 Million RM23.74 Million RM18.68 Million ▲ +12.2 pp
2008 0.8% RM255.09K RM32.45 Million RM20.13 Million RM19.88 Million ▲ +2.4 pp
2007 -1.6% RM-506.37K RM31.97 Million RM16.41 Million RM16.91 Million ▼ -6.0 pp
2006 4.4% RM1.46 Million RM33.07 Million RM18.43 Million RM16.97 Million
pp = percentage points
